柱前衍生高效液相色谱法测定胎盘多肽注射液中的氨基酸  被引量:11

Determination of amino acids in Placenta Polypeptide Injection by high performance liquid chromatography with pre-column AQC derivatization

摘  要:目的建立柱前衍生-高效液相色谱法测定胎盘多肽注射液中游离氨基酸和水解后总氨基酸的方法。方法以α-氨基丁酸为内标,以6-氨基喹啉基-N-羟基琥珀酰亚氨基甲酸酯(AQC)为柱前衍生化试剂,采用KromasilC18(250 mm×4.6 mm,5μm)色谱柱,140 mmol/L醋酸铵缓冲液(pH 5.10)和57%乙腈溶液为流动相进行梯度洗脱,检测波长为248 nm,同时测定胎盘多肽注射液中21种游离氨基酸和水解后氨基酸含量。结果该方法重现性好,精密度高,各氨基酸浓度在0.005~0.50 mmol/L范围内线性关系良好;各氨基酸检出限≤1.57 ng。结论建立的AQC柱前衍生-高效液相色谱法可用于检测胎盘多肽注射液中氨基酸的含量,测定的结果为胎盘多肽注射液的质量研究和评价提供了依据。Purpose To establish a pre-column derivatization method with HPLC for the determination of amino acids in Placenta Polypeptide Injection.Methods The sample was mixed with 2-amino butyric acid as the internal standard,derivatized with 6-aminoquinolyl-N-hydroxysuccinimidyl carbamate(AQC) and analyzed on a Kromasil C18 column(250 mm×4.6 mm,5 μm),ammonium acetate solution(pH 5.10) and acetonitrile solution as mobile phase,using gradient elution with detection at 248 nm.Results All 21 amino acid derivatives were separated well when an optimized elution condition was applied.Consequently,good reproducibility,high sensitivity and high precision of the method were achieved.This method had a good linearity when the amino acid concentration w as set at the range of 0.005-0.50 mmol/L,and the detector limit of each amino acids was lower than 0.5 pmol.Conclusion The method could be used for determination of content of amino acids in Placenta Polypeptide Injection.
